This easy, fresh blood orange salad with red onion and mint can be whipped up so quickly, is loaded with health benefits, and great for a refreshing side or lunch.

Blood Orange Salad with Red Onion & Mint [Vegan]

Serves

6

Cooking Time

15

Ingredients You Need for Blood Orange Salad with Red Onion & Mint [Vegan]

  • 6 blood oranges, cut into supremes
  • 1 small red onion, sliced
  • 1 large handful of fresh mint, chopped
  • 1 teaspoon fresh thyme
  • 1/4 cup pistachios, roughly chopped
  • 2 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on sea sal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 cup vegan feta, optional

How to Prepare Blood Orange Salad with Red Onion & Mint [Vegan]

  1. To a salad bowl begin supreming the blood orange and squeeze each to remove excess juice.
  2. Add the rest of your ingredients to the salad bowl and gently toss.
  3. Enjoy!

Notes

If you don’t have blood oranges, it works great with grapefruit or any orange variety. Have fun with your herb choices; any herbs work in this!
